Q&A: How can I overcome the feeling of disgust when I’m cooking meat?

Question by Lily: How can I overcome the feeling of disgust when I’m cooking meat?
Umm, so I just started cooking, and I’ve been really grossed out whenever I had to rinse a chicken with its head cut off, slice off its legs and cut it into pieces. It just makes me really uncomfortable and almost want to throw up. Is this feeling normal for new cooks? And how do I overcome the feeling of disgust?

Best answer:

Answer by whiskwattlebagjam
I think that the more you do it the more you’ll get used to it but I don’t think you’ll ever find it a joyous experience.

Soldier on!

Is religion responsible for people having a disgust reaction to sexual images?

Question by Desiree: Is religion responsible for people having a disgust reaction to sexual images?
I think a disgust reaction is like an instinctual defense mechanism that operates without volition; creatures with it react with revulsion to whatever they’re seeing, tasting, visualizing etc. Humans have evolved with this disgust reaction and it helps us avoid things that might be harmful. But why do sexual images make us react with disgust? I mean, they’re not harmful to us. Does it have something to do with religions that have been telling us for centuries that sex is disgusting and sinful?

Best answer:

Answer by The Truth
I think that it is a need for privacy.
